How the Poll is Conducted

Ever wondered how these polls actually work? The OSCElectionsC Poll, like many others, uses a mix of methodologies to gather data. This often includes telephone surveys, online questionnaires, and sometimes even in-person interviews. The goal is to reach a representative sample of the population, ensuring that the results reflect the views of the broader electorate. Getting a diverse and representative sample is critical to the accuracy of the poll.

Random sampling is a key technique. This means that every eligible voter has an equal chance of being selected for the poll. This helps minimize bias and ensures that the results are more likely to be an accurate reflection of the population. However, it's not always perfect. Some people are more likely to participate in polls than others, which can skew the results. That’s where weighting comes in.

Weighting is a statistical technique used to adjust the results to better match the demographic characteristics of the population. For example, if the poll underrepresents a certain age group or ethnicity, the responses from those groups might be given extra weight to compensate. This helps to correct for any imbalances in the sample and improve the accuracy of the poll.

Factors Influencing the Poll

Okay, so what factors could be influencing the OSCElectionsC Poll 2024? A ton of stuff, actually! One major factor is media coverage. The way the media frames the candidates and their positions can have a huge impact on public opinion. A candidate who receives positive media coverage is more likely to see their poll numbers rise, while negative coverage can have the opposite effect. Debates are also crucial. A strong performance in a debate can give a candidate a significant boost, while a poor performance can be damaging.

Endorsements from prominent figures can also sway voters. An endorsement from a popular politician, celebrity, or organization can lend credibility to a candidate and attract new supporters. Economic conditions also play a big role. If the economy is doing well, voters are more likely to support the incumbent party. If the economy is struggling, they may be more inclined to vote for change.

Global events can also have an impact. A major international crisis or conflict can shift voters' priorities and influence their choice of candidate. And let's not forget about social media, which has become an increasingly powerful tool for campaigns to reach voters and shape the narrative. A viral video, a clever meme, or a well-crafted social media campaign can all have a significant impact on the race.
